Transaction 49fc80b26e37511ba551f6d801a604ca16ee26eed3333d5d498bfd00a2f84db6

1 Input
2 Outputs
  • 49fc80b26e37511ba551f6d801a604ca16ee26eed3333d5d498bfd00a2f84db6:0
  • value  2078650
    address  376bfzh1eVCEmcYXBUdY7H9o7tbRMQ1MrX
  • 49fc80b26e37511ba551f6d801a604ca16ee26eed3333d5d498bfd00a2f84db6:1
  • value  609617
    address  3HuGHJ4CcBB941SDiTbUKV8LpFSzzL66cZ